Dead coin battery

Modern electronic key fobs offer more security and convenience than traditional keys. They can lock and unlock the vehicle, turn on lights and start the engine. They come with additional features that allow you to drive more easily. However, they can lose their charge over time. If you're Jaguar XF key fob has stopped working, it could be due to the fact that the coin battery is dead. It's simple to replace.

Crofton drivers will know it's time to replace the battery when their key fob ceases to function or becomes less effective at locking and unlocking from at a distance. You may also see an email on your Jaguar InControl (r) touchscreen interface that reads "Smart key battery low".

Slide the blade of the emergency key out to expose the cover of the key fob. Then pull the emergency key to take out the chrome side bits, and then break the two pieces of the key fob's body. Replace the old battery, ensuring that the positive side is facing upward.

Faulty receiver module

The key fob transmits an radio signal at a low-frequency that is detected by a receiver module in the Jaguar. The module receives a signal from your smart key and activates or deactivates your security system. The module also lets you to start your vehicle and control the audio system. If the receiver module is faulty it may stop working. To resolve the problem remove the battery with 12 volts by disconnecting it from both terminals and waiting for about a couple of minutes. Then, reconnect the battery in reverse order.
